  • How to add a 2nd hard drive for HP Pavilion DV7!

    How to add a 2nd hard drive for HP Pavilion DV7-3165DX, product # WA794UA or WA794UAR.

    (1) classification of the HDD, hard drive, hardware kit. Disc kit HARD material includes mounting rails, static shield, screws, insulators in rubber and SATA cable from the motherboard. Check your model & product # to ensure compatibility.

    Material of parts HP HDD Kit 517639-001 for DV7-3165DX product # WA794UA and WA794UAR.

    (2) training of consult - Windows 7 PDF, table of contents, 7 replacing a drive in secondary hard drive Bay. This will show you how to install a 2nd HARD drive in an HP DV7.

    Readers - Windows 7 PDF

    (3) to select a Windows 7 computer, select the installed HDD, Format (if not already formatted).

    (4) if the drive HARD does not appear in Windows 7 under computer, go to the Start Menu, find programs and files, enter "Computer management", select storage, disk (Local) management, look for the 2 HARD drive Bay (should appear as disk 1, Bay 1 HARD drive should show as disk 0), Format of the 2nd HARD drive (the one that you just installed).

    Update: I have the 2nd HDD (WD 1 TB) installed, Windows recognize now after completing the steps I mentioned in step 4, Format with default allocation NTFS 931,51 GB free, 118 MB USED to put in shape. Format exFAT to allocation by default 931,51 GB free, 1 MB used to put in shape. I chose NTFS format to reduce the fragmentation of the file.

    How to encode a Toshiba hard drive serial number?

    Toshiba serial number (S/N) includes the date of manufacture. The first digit of the serial number indicates the month of manufacture and the 2nd digit is the year.

    Example:
    M Y x x x x x x x
    M = month
    Y = year

    Data for the month goes from 1, for January, by 9 in September, then X, Y and Z, for October, November and December.

    Examples:
    2 8 1 7 0 0 0 1
    2 = February
    8 = 1998

    3 0 5 4 4 3 0 6 T
    3 = March
    0 = 2000

    X 9 7 8 3 3 1 T
    X = October
    9 = 1999

    The remaining digits contain information about the plant and the production line, and some numbers are reserved for a continuously running serial number.
